“…That sidebar saving goes along with significantly reduced right DLPFC activity during subsequent arithmetic tasks fits well with the notion that beneficial effects of cognitive offloading on current task execution are mediated by reduced working memory load 8 . The DLPFC has a crucial role in working memory processes 22 , 23 . In particular, it has been assumed that the DLPFC is tasked with upholding, updating and manipulating task relevant information 24 .…”
